Bill Summary
Relative to licensure of equine dentists. Consumer Protection and Professional Licensure.
AI Summary
This bill aims to establish a licensing and regulation framework for equine (horse) dental practitioners in the state. It defines an "equine dental practitioner" as either a veterinarian or someone certified by the International Association of Equine Dentistry. The bill sets application requirements, including being at least 18 years old, of good moral character, and certified by the International Association of Equine Dentistry. It also allows the licensing board to refuse or revoke a license, and requires annual license renewal and continuing education for licensed practitioners.
